There are two ways you can do it.
First, when you're logged into your return, go to the upper margin of the screen and click on My Account. Then from the dropdown box select Tools. When the Tool Center window opens, click on the first item in the list of Other Helpful Links, View Tax Summary. When the summary page loads, look up above the summary and click on Preview My 1040. That will show you the two-page 1040 form for you to review.
Second, if you want to see all the various forms & schedules that are included with the 1040, then you'll need to pay first (you won't have to file yet). Once you've made payment, then again go to My Account, click on Print Center from the dropdown box, and you'll be able to print/download the entire tax return, including all forms & schedules.

Before filing, You can preview the 1040 or print the whole return
In the online version you have to pay to prepare the state return whether you efile or print and mail it. So you have to pay all the fees before you can print.
